It\u2019s an anti-Christmas\u200d movie.\u2064 This is why every year a debate erupts on\u2062 the internet over whether it\u200b is truly a Christmas film.<\/p>\n<div class=\"fdrlst__b89e9-paragraph-2-long d-flex justify-content-center\" style=\"marg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to; text-align: center; \" id=\"fdrlst__b89e9-1318959492\">\n<div id=\"div-gpt-ad-1379703300879-0\" class=\"mb-30\"><\/div>\n<\/div>\n<div class=\"fdrlst__b89e9-be60152e1e1535c15491334f2264b41e fdrlst__b89e9-paragraph-2\" id=\"fdrlst__b89e9-be60152e1e1535c15491334f2264b41e\"><\/div>\n<p>There are at least two kinds\u200d of Christmas movies. The\u2064 first are movies that\u200b are actually\u200c about Christmas, films like \u201cA Christmas Story\u201d\u2064 from 1983. As\u2064 the title\u200b suggests, it\u2019s a story about Christmas, told from the perspective of a midwestern elementary-aged boy. The second type of Christmas movies are \u2063films that are \u200bset during Christmas, but really the plot is seasonally\u2063 interchangeable. For instance, \u201cHome Alone\u201d\u2062 is set during Christmas, but it could have been set during \u200cThanksgiving and\u200c relatively little would change. \u201cPlanes, Trains,\u2062 and Automobiles\u201d likewise is set during Thanksgiving but could have taken place at Christmas.<\/p>\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">The Christmas Movie Genre<\/h2>\n<p>I think it\u2019s fair to say that the \u2064first category is the real Christmas films. Films that start with\u2063 Christmas\u200c as an essential element and \u2062are clearly about Christmas are obviously Christmas movies. The problem \u2064is that Christmas is so much more evocative \u2062than any other holiday that by \u2063setting your film at\u2064 Christmas, \u200dyou\u200c have done something to it. There\u2019s a reason we don\u2019t really have a genre called summer movies\u200b or Easter movies. Setting a film at Christmas is a \u200dstorytelling choice.<\/p>\n<p>For instance, Shane Black, the genius writer and director behind amazing films like \u201cKiss\u200d Kiss,\u2062 Bang Bang,\u201d \u201cLethal Weapon,\u201d and \u201cIron Man 3\u201d sets virtually all his films at Christmas in L.A. He does this in part because it gives a film a particular vibe, a\u2063 complicated noirish one. Anyone who \u2063has lived in L.A.\u200b and experienced an L.A. Christmas understands why this is, and it\u2019s difficult to convey\u2062 to the uninitiated. There is something about L.A. that is at odds with Christmas \u2063itself.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cDie Hard\u201d almost could\u200b be a Shane\u200b Black film, since it is set in L.A. at \u2064Christmastime. \u201cLethal \u2062Weapon\u201d beat it \u200bto cinemas by a year. But \u200bthere are a surprising \u2064number of action \u200cfilms\u200b set at Christmas in L.A. \u201cCobra\u201d \u2063from 1986 was \u2063Stallone\u2019s attempt at an L.A. <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/where-have-all-the-sex-scenes-gone\/\" title=\"Where Have All the Sex Scenes Gone?\">cop movie<\/a>. Inexplicably, it is set at Christmas. William Friedkin\u2019s \u2063nihilistic \u201cTo\u2063 Live and Die in L.A.\u201d from 1985\u2063 is likewise set at Christmas.<\/p>\n<div class=\"fdrlst__b89e9-c50873d8173c615e4a85f2c8e35c522d fdrlst__b89e9-paragraph-6\" id=\"fdrlst__b89e9-c50873d8173c615e4a85f2c8e35c522d\"><\/div>\n<p>It was clearly\u200b a trend \u200bin the \u201980s to set your L.A. action film at Christmastime.\u2063 I\u200c think the reason \u200bfor this \u200cis twofold. Film is a visual medium, and Christmas is the most visually oriented Western holiday. Setting a film at \u200cChristmas gives it some visual distinction. \u200bBut it also gives\u2063 it some thematic heft. Think about\u200d how many films don\u2019t really have a seasonal setting. Dates \u2062and times of year are relatively insignificant in a comedy like \u201cDumb and Dumber.\u201d Does it \u2063really matter what time of year \u201cCasablanca\u201d \u2064takes place?<\/p>\n<p>Sometimes Christmas can take over a film. \u201cHome Alone\u201d feels like\u2062 a Christmas movie because setting it \u200bat Christmas raises the stakes \u200cfor Kevin and his isolation from his family.\u2062 Missing \u200dout on the yearly Thanksgiving trip doesn\u2019t have the same tragic \u200dquality \u200cas being forgotten \u2062at \u200cChristmas. Christmas is about salvation, a cosmic reorientation away \u200cfrom the old pagan world into the new Christian one. I doubt that\u200d if the film had been set at Thanksgiving\u2064 one of the \u200bmost memorable scenes would have happened, the church conversation with\u2062 the old man. Christmas\u2064 conquers \u201cHome Alone\u201d in\u200b a way that \u200bno other holiday can \u200ctake over a\u2064 movie.<\/p>\n<p><strong>[READ:[READ:<a href=\"https:\/\/thefederalist.com\/2023\/12\/08\/the-definitive-answer-to-is-die-hard-a-christmas-movie\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">The Definitive Answer\u2062 To \u2018Is Die Hard A\u200d Christmas Movie?\u2019<\/a>]<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>I\u2019ve seen ironic attempts\u2064 to\u200b show \u2063how \u201cDie Hard\u201d \u200dhas Christian themes, and that\u2062 is all they are: ironic. Great Christmas comedies\u2063 like \u201cA Christmas Story\u201d \u200band \u201cChristmas Vacation\u201d are funny because of their silly human elements. \u200cChristmas celebrations can bring out the weirdest things \u200cin us because humans are\u2062 ridiculous, especially\u200b in familial settings.<\/p>\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">American Christmas: Sadness, Isolation, and\u200b Materialism<\/h2>\n<p>\u201cDie Hard\u2019s\u201d connection to Christmas is\u200d to parody the \u200dvery idea of heavenly justice. At the beginning \u200bof the film, John McClane is \u200dnot a family man. He has\u2062 failed his family. His children and wife have moved to L.A. He\u2019s deeply \u200cunhappy. There is nothing for him to celebrate this Christmas; his life is in shambles. Yes, the film ends with him being reunited with his wife, but as the franchise\u200d bears out, he\u2019s still \u200da\u2063 bad father\u200b and husband,\u200b so the reunion is fleeting. \u200bDefeating some extraordinary thieves hasn\u2019t changed him \u2062in any remotely moral way. He\u2019s \u200cnot improved as a person, he\u2019s\u2064 just killed some bad\u2063 guys and saved some \u2063lives.<\/p>\n<p>But maybe more important is the gleeful\u2064 abandon that the\u200d villains exhibit throughout the film. If you really want to understand what this film has to say about Christmas, you need to\u200c look no further than the scene where they finally open \u2063the vault. \u2062Beethoven\u2019s \u2063\u201cOde to Joy\u201d plays,\u200d reaching a \u2062crescendo when the\u2063 vault\u200b opens\u200b and \u200bthe bad guy\u2019s tech expert smiles and exuberantly says: \u201cMerry Christmas.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The \u200bvillains are celebrating Christmas \u2014 but not\u2063 the\u200d Christmas of Christ and George Bailey. They are celebrating what American decadence has done\u200c to Christmas. This\u2062 film \u200cis taking the most cynical (and sadly \u2062often truthful) view of what Christmas has come to mean in America. Christmas means divorced loser dads having\u200c to travel cross country. Christmas means sadness,\u200d isolation, and materialism \u200dfor so many Americans.<\/p>\n<p>What \u200cit\u2019s saying about what Christmas has become is not untrue, but it is un-Christmas. It is an anti-Christmas movie. \u2064In some ways,\u2064 this\u2064 is as close America may ever come \u2063to the scathing moral indictment of Christmas envisioned by Dickens almost\u200b two \u200dcenturies ago. The difference is that <em>A \u2062Christmas Carol<\/em> ends with repentance and hope. \u201cDie Hard\u201d ends with a gunshot.<\/p>\n<p>Every year at his theater in L.A., Quentin Tarantino shows \u201cDie Hard\u201d to celebrate Christmas. And if\u2063 you\u2019ve seen any of Tarantino\u2019s films, that <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/graham-if-democrats-call-witnesses-at-trial-we-will-call-democrats-thatve-used-inflammatory-language\/\" title=\"Graham: If Democrats Call Witnesses At Trial We Will Call Democrats That\u2019ve Used Inflammatory Language\">makes perfect sense<\/a>. His vision of the world melds \u2063with this film\u2019s take on Christmas perfectly. People\u200c love to have an excuse to\u200b watch this film because it\u2019s incredibly entertaining, so they use Christmas as their reason. \u2063It\u2019s a Tarantino-esque \u200bChristmas tradition. And that \u2062is why\u2063 the debate goes \u2064on, because this\u2064 film simply does \u2064not fit into what Christmas is actually\u2064 about.<\/p>\n<p>The continued popularity of \u201cDie Hard,\u201d and the perennial debate over whether it\u2019s a Christmas movie, shows that Christmas has not conquered L.A. or \u201cDie \u200dHard.\u201d Rather, in some sense, \u201cDie Hard\u201d\u2063 has\u200d conquered Christmas. That makes it, by definition, an anti-Christmas movie. And this is why the debate will \u2064go on: because it\u2019s a film that is fundamentally in\u200d conflict with the holiday it\u2019s used to celebrate.<\/p>\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ator\">\n<\/div>\n<p> <\/p>\n<h2> \u2064 In what \u2063ways does &#8220;Die Hard&#8221; fail to capture the true spirit \u2062of \u200cChristmas, and why do its themes of violence, materialism, \u2062and\u200d isolation \u2062make it an anti-Christmas \u2063movie<\/h2>\n<p><span>  \u200b Lt.
